Chain Name Support
The CLI accepts human-readable chain names and resolves them automatically.
| Chain | Name | chainIndex |
|---|---|---|
| XLayer | xlayer | 196 |
| Solana | solana | 501 |
| Ethereum | ethereum | 1 |
| Base | base | 8453 |
| BSC | bsc | 56 |
| Arbitrum | arbitrum | 42161 |
Command Index
| # | Command | Description |
|---|---|---|
| 1 | onchainos gateway chains | Get supported chains for gateway |
| 2 | onchainos gateway gas --chain <chain> | Get current gas prices for a chain |
| 3 | onchainos gateway gas-limit --from ... --to ... --chain ... | Estimate gas limit for a transaction |
| 4 | onchainos gateway simulate --from ... --to ... --data ... --chain ... | Simulate a transaction (dry-run) |
| 5 | onchainos gateway broadcast --signed-tx ... --address ... --chain ... | Broadcast a signed transaction |
| 6 | onchainos gateway orders --address ... --chain ... | Track broadcast order status |

CLI Command Reference
1. onchainos gateway chains
Get supported chains for gateway. No parameters required.
onchainos gateway chains
Return fields:
| Field | Type | Description |
|---|---|---|
chainIndex | String | Chain identifier (e.g., "1", "501") |
name | String | Human-readable chain name (e.g., "Ethereum") |
logoUrl | String | Chain logo image URL |
shortName | String | Chain short name (e.g., "ETH") |
2. onchainos gateway gas
Get current gas prices for a chain.
onchainos gateway gas --chain <chain>
| Param | Required | Default | Description |
|---|---|---|---|
--chain | Yes | - | Chain name (e.g., ethereum, solana, xlayer) |
Return fields:
| Field | Type | Description |
|---|---|---|
normal | String | Normal gas price (legacy) |
min | String | Minimum gas price |
max | String | Maximum gas price |
supporteip1559 | Boolean | Whether EIP-1559 is supported |
eip1559Protocol.suggestBaseFee | String | Suggested base fee |
eip1559Protocol.baseFee | String | Current base fee |
eip1559Protocol.proposePriorityFee | String | Proposed priority fee |
eip1559Protocol.safePriorityFee | String | Safe (slow) priority fee |
eip1559Protocol.fastPriorityFee | String | Fast priority fee |
For Solana chains: proposePriorityFee, safePriorityFee, fastPriorityFee, extremePriorityFee.
3. onchainos gateway gas-limit
Estimate gas limit for a transaction.
onchainos gateway gas-limit --from <address> --to <address> --chain <chain> [--amount <amount>] [--data <hex>]
| Param | Required | Default | Description |
|---|---|---|---|
--from | Yes | - | Sender address |
--to | Yes | - | Recipient / contract address |
--chain | Yes | - | Chain name |
--amount | No | "0" | Transfer value in minimal units |
--data | No | - | Encoded calldata (hex, for contract interactions) |
Return fields:
| Field | Type | Description |
|---|---|---|
gasLimit | String | Estimated gas limit for the transaction |
4. onchainos gateway simulate
Simulate a transaction (dry-run).
onchainos gateway simulate --from <address> --to <address> --data <hex> --chain <chain> [--amount <amount>]
| Param | Required | Default | Description |
|---|---|---|---|
--from | Yes | - | Sender address |
--to | Yes | - | Recipient / contract address |
--data | Yes | - | Encoded calldata (hex) |
--chain | Yes | - | Chain name |
--amount | No | "0" | Transfer value in minimal units |
Return fields:
| Field | Type | Description |
|---|---|---|
intention | String | Transaction intent description |
assetChange[] | Array | Asset changes from the simulation |
assetChange[].symbol | String | Token symbol |
assetChange[].rawValue | String | Raw amount change |
gasUsed | String | Gas consumed in simulation |
failReason | String | Failure reason (empty string = success) |
risks[] | Array | Risk information |
5. onchainos gateway broadcast
Broadcast a signed transaction.
onchainos gateway broadcast --signed-tx <tx> --address <address> --chain <chain>
| Param | Required | Default | Description |
|---|---|---|---|
--signed-tx | Yes | - | Fully signed transaction (hex for EVM, base58 for Solana) |
--address | Yes | - | Sender wallet address |
--chain | Yes | - | Chain name |
Return fields:
| Field | Type | Description |
|---|---|---|
orderId | String | OKX order tracking ID (use for order status queries) |
txHash | String | On-chain transaction hash |
6. onchainos gateway orders
Track broadcast order status.
onchainos gateway orders --address <address> --chain <chain> [--order-id <id>]
| Param | Required | Default | Description |
|---|---|---|---|
--address | Yes | - | Wallet address |
--chain | Yes | - | Chain name |
--order-id | No | - | Specific order ID (from broadcast response) |
Return fields:
| Field | Type | Description |
|---|---|---|
cursor | String | Pagination cursor for next page |
orders[] | Array | List of order objects |
orders[].orderId | String | OKX order tracking ID |
orders[].txHash | String | On-chain transaction hash |
orders[].chainIndex | String | Chain identifier |
orders[].address | String | Wallet address |
orders[].txStatus | String | Transaction status: 1 = Pending, 2 = Success, 3 = Failed |
orders[].failReason | String | Failure reason (empty if successful) |

Edge Cases
- MEV protection: Broadcasting through OKX nodes may offer MEV protection on supported chains.
- Solana special handling: Solana signed transactions use base58 encoding (not hex). Ensure the
--signed-txformat matches the chain. - Chain not supported: call
onchainos gateway chainsfirst to verify. - Node return failed: the underlying blockchain node rejected the transaction. Common causes: insufficient gas, nonce too low, contract revert. Retry with corrected parameters.
- Wallet type mismatch: the address format does not match the chain (e.g., EVM address on Solana chain).
- Network error: retry once, then prompt user to try again later
- Region restriction (error code 50125 or 80001): do NOT show the raw error code to the user. Instead, display a friendly message:
⚠️ Service is not available in your region. Please switch to a supported region and try again. - Transaction already broadcast: if the same
--signed-txis broadcast twice, the API may return an error or the sametxHash— handle idempotently.
Amount Display Rules
- Gas prices in Gwei for EVM chains (
18.5 Gwei), never raw wei - Gas limit as integer (
21000,145000) - USD gas cost estimate when possible
- Transaction values in UI units (
1.5 ETH), never base units
Global Notes
- This skill does NOT sign transactions — it only broadcasts pre-signed transactions
- Amounts in parameters use minimal units (wei/lamports)
- Gas price fields: use
eip1559Protocol.suggestBaseFee+proposePriorityFeefor EIP-1559 chains,normalfor legacy - EVM contract addresses must be all lowercase
- The CLI resolves chain names automatically (e.g.,
ethereum→1,solana→501) - The CLI handles authentication internally via environment variables — see Prerequisites step 4 for default values
